Aniela Shauck at WSU Insider Wrote:Washington State University will soon begin offering a new online master’s program aimed at providing students with a foundational understanding of environmentally friendly construction practices.
The Master’s in Energy Conscious Construction program, launching this spring, will train students in the design of more efficient and less carbon polluting homes for the future. […] The master’s program will offer a series of 10 courses and online learning modules. Students will earn a total of 30 credits through the program, following either a one-year or two-year path. The program, housed in the School of Design and Construction and offered through WSU Global Campus, is for students as well as for working professionals.
New master’s degree program aims for more environmentally friendly construction (Aniela Shauck,
WSU Insider, October 24, 2024)
